On Fermion Zero-Modes in Instanton $V-A$ Models With Spontaneous Symmetry Breaking

Abstract

The left and right handed fermion zero-modes are examined. Their behaviour under the variation of the size of the instanton, \ri\ri, and the size of the Higgs core, \rh\rh, for a range of Yukawa couplings corresponding to the fermion masses in the electroweak theory are studied. It is shown that the characteristic radii of the zero-modes, in particlar those the left handed fermions, are locked to the instanton size, and are not affected by the variation of \rh\rh, except for fermion masses much larger than those in the standard electroweak theory.
